How to Identify Good Investment Opportunities
When you're looking for a property with strong investment potential, consider the area's rental demand, overall security, and upcoming developments. A helpful guideline is to look for neighborhoods with consistent employment growth and urban renewal strategies.
Indicators of a profitable investment are:
- Proximity to local facilities such as educational institutions and shopping.
- Future infrastructure projects or local renovations.
- A history of stable or improving property values.
